Output 385006c2181b4cf7578c66e506b3a49dd728717dc53a3f9b750e4aa403e834ed:3

value
672153
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d300962087ddcf5fda6c1fc49a4d6898fd8c3c29 OP_EQUALVERIFY OP_CHECKSIG
address
1LEgHDu1shVdjWLSQ8TFXD3M9rQHsoa2dc
transaction
385006c2181b4cf7578c66e506b3a49dd728717dc53a3f9b750e4aa403e834ed
spent
true